two.1.4) Short description
This service provides specialist psychosexual therapy as part of an integrated sexual health offering. It supports individuals and couples experiencing difficulties related to sexual function, intimacy, and relationships. The service is delivered by qualified therapists using evidence-based approaches, aiming to improve sexual wellbeing, mental health, and quality of life.

two.2.4) Description of the procurement
This procurement relates to the direct award of a contract for the provision of Psychosexual Therapy Services under Direct Award Process C of the Provider Selection Regime (PSR), as set out in the Health Care Services (Provider Selection Regime) Regulations 2023.
The contracting authority has determined that the existing provider, Family Action, is to continue delivering the service following expiry of the current contract. This decision is based on an assessment of the provider’s performance and suitability against the five key criteria of the PSR:
Quality and Innovation – The provider has consistently delivered high-quality services with evidence of innovation and continuous improvement.
Value – The provider offers good value for money, with efficient use of resources and positive outcomes.
Integration and Collaboration – The provider is well-integrated with local health and care systems and collaborates effectively with partners.
Access, Inequalities and Choice – The service supports equitable access and addresses health inequalities in the local population.
Social Value – The provider contributes positively to the wider social, economic, and environmental wellbeing of the community.
A Contract Award Notice will be published in accordance with PSR requirements. A standstill period of 8 days will be observed prior to contract commencement.
